一些浏览器也通过了另一个潜在的延期。在创建具有无限精度的无限酥脆图像的渲染引擎之后,一些SVG用户返回并决定如果它们可能是Blurrier,则会决定图像可能会更好。(有些人从不开心。)在任何情况下,Chrome,Opera和Firefox提供SVG过滤器那么平均所有附近的像素,以产生更平滑的,更漂亮,通常是奇异的效果,这些效果并没有像线条图一样冷或清晰。
我的快速SVG测试提供一种方法来检查浏览器托管嵌入式和框架SVG标签的能力。一个好的收藏SVG示例和测试Andre M.冬季收集的冬季显示了人们对基本SVG标准进行实验的许多方式,以及若干建议的添加和延伸。
当前和未来浏览器中的本机SVG支持
在CSS背景中显示HTML SVG过滤器SVG字体SVG的SVG SVG效果SVG动画
Safari 5.0 / 6.0是/是部分/部分否/是是/是是/是是/是
Chrome 8.0 / 9.0是/是部分/部分部分/部分是/是是/是是/是
IE 8.0 / 9.0否/是否/部分否/否/否否/是否/否
Firefox 3.6 / 4.0是/是是/是是/是否/否否/是否/是
Opera 10.60 / 11.0是/是部分/部分是/是是/是是/是是/是是/是
WebGL:3D Canvas
WebGL格式有助于将OpenGL的所有权力带到画布。许多主要浏览器的开发版本已经支持它,但他们在开始时不会打开这一点。您需要通过绑定一些配置文件来激活它。例如,Chrome要求您从命令行启动浏览器,并包含参数--enable-WebGL。Firefox允许您从ADIO:CONFIG页面(键入:config“进入地址栏中的WEWGL)。
该技术不是HTML5标准的正式一部分,但许多人在同一上下文中提到它,因为它既是实验性的,并绑在帆布物体上。当然,性能大量取决于您的视频卡和可用的内存。具有功能强大的图形硬件报告的用户在每秒20到30帧时运行Quake 2的开源端口。
萨尔加萨尔加萨尔加提供了一系列WEBGL例程这测试了大部分规格的角落。
更多HTML5善良
接下来的几篇文章将深入挖掘HTML5标准的各种增强功能,其中许多是隐藏的视图。虽然
所有这些新的HTML5功能都将从根本上扩展Web应用程序的能力,而不是一堆链接。
这个故事,“浏览器中的HTML5:画布,视频,音频和图形”最初发布infoworld. 。